LIve in MD and state taxes withheld in WV

I live in Maryland and state taxes are withheld in WV.  What state returns do I have to file?  Does Turbo tax walk me through this process?

MD and WV have tax reciprocity.

Do you work in WV?  If so, your W-2 earnings are not subject to WV withholding.  Those earnings are taxable by your home state of MD.

If that's your situation, you should file WV Form WV/IT-104 with your employer in order to stop the WV withholding.  Here's a link to that form (scroll down to bottom half of form): https://tax.wv.gov/Documents/TaxForms/it104.pdf

And you'll need to file a non-resident WV tax return, showing zero WV income, in order to obtain a refund of the incorrectly withheld WV taxes.
